Released November 23rd, 1995, 'Poopie Parade of Values' stars Kevin Murphy, Michael J. Nelson, Trace Beaulieu The movie has a runtime of about 17 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which compiled reviews from respected users.

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Infomercial about two tapes the MST3K Info Club on sale: The "Poopie!" tape of bloopers and "The MST Scrapbook", a video diary from the early days on KTMA until Season 6. Multiple clips of both tapes are shown." .
